  1. 1 Whether the Agreement concerned transfer of HSR shareholding (Heshan Factory) or sale of the Lionstar business and IP
  2. 2 Whether Steve, Vic and Fuku made fraudulent misrepresentations as to title to HSR
  3. 3 Whether the Agreement should be rescinded for fraud and the consequences of rescission

Ratio Decidendi

Where a party knowingly or recklessly makes false representations as to title to the subject matter inducing another to enter a contract, the contract is voidable for fraudulent misrepresentation; the representee may rescind the contract ab initio and recover restitution and damages, and the individual representors are personally liable; applying these principles, the Agreement was rescinded and damages awarded to Rakich Investments.

Court Disposition

Judgment for Rakich Camp on counterclaim; Fuku's original claim dismissed for want of prosecution; Agreement rescinded and declared void ab initio.

Orders

  • Declaration that the Agreement dated 16 March 2018 has been rescinded and is void ab initio
  • Fuku Group Limited's claims in HCA 2400/2018 dismissed
